Who plays India in nocturnal animals?

Ellie Bamber It opens with Tony (Jake Gyllenhaal), packing up the family's old Mercedes for a trip to Marfa, Tex. Before long, he, his wife, Laura (Isla Fisher), and their teenage daughter, India (Ellie Bamber), are driving in the pitch-black West Texas evening, seemingly alone on a two-lane highway.

Why does Edward Stand Susan up?

After writing the novel, Edward sends it to Susan, the first communication they've had in years. He felt empowered to do that. He felt so empowered that he then stood Susan up.

What did Susan do in nocturnal animals?

Susan is an art gallery owner. One day, she receives an “unexpected” manuscript from her estranged ex-husband Edward. He dedicated the book to her and now he wants to know her opinion. “Nocturnal Animal” used to be Edward's nickname for Susan.

What was the point of the movie Nocturnal Animals?

One of the core themes of Nocturnal Animals is that the past is never really quite through with us. Tony Hastings lives his life for a year before finding out that the men who hurt his wife and daughter are back on the radar. He could move on, but instead, he spirals into violence until he winds up dead.
